草庐IT

remote-desktop-session-locks-work

全部标签

php - 禁用 cookie 时 PHP session 如何工作?

我试图研究这种机制,但只找到了一些提示,而且这些提示并不是很一致。session_id是如何发送给浏览器的,当用户请求新页面时,浏览器又是如何指示返回的?谢谢,克里斯 最佳答案 PHP会做两件事:它将重写所有链接以传递一个额外的GET参数,通常是PHPSESSID但这可以通过在php.ini中设置session.name来更改它会添加一个隐藏的同名输入打开标签。请注意,这是一件危险的事情,因为任何人,例如,复制/粘贴包含PHPSESSID参数的URL将能够在网站上共享您的登录session-网络服务器没有简单的方法来告诉您您与发送链

php - 通知 : Undefined variable: _SESSION in "" on line 9

这个问题在这里已经有了答案:Undefinedvariable:$_SESSION(4个回答)关闭9年前。这是我的php代码:MemberIndexWelcomeMyProfile|LogoutThisisapasswordprotectedareaonlyaccessibletomembers.我知道我的代码有问题,但我不知道如何修复它。我的错误说:“注意:undefinedvariable:第9行C:\xampp\htdocs\Smasher\member-index.php中的_SESSION”如何修复错误,使其显示用户的名字?mySQL上数据库表中的第一个名称称为fname。

php - 通知 : Undefined variable: _SESSION in "" on line 9

这个问题在这里已经有了答案:Undefinedvariable:$_SESSION(4个回答)关闭9年前。这是我的php代码:MemberIndexWelcomeMyProfile|LogoutThisisapasswordprotectedareaonlyaccessibletomembers.我知道我的代码有问题,但我不知道如何修复它。我的错误说:“注意:undefinedvariable:第9行C:\xampp\htdocs\Smasher\member-index.php中的_SESSION”如何修复错误,使其显示用户的名字?mySQL上数据库表中的第一个名称称为fname。

php - Yii2中如何添加更多的用户身份 session 属性?

在Yii2中,您可以通过使用\yii\web\User类中的identityInterface对象来访问当前用户的身份接口(interface)\Yii::$app->user->identity->id;有没有办法获取和设置额外的参数(无需扩展身份类)?基本上等同于Yii1.xgetState()和CWebUser中的setState()方法来存储和检索session信息,例如这个Yii::app()->user->setState("some_attribute",$value);Yii::app()->user->getState('some_attribute',$defaul

php - Yii2中如何添加更多的用户身份 session 属性?

在Yii2中,您可以通过使用\yii\web\User类中的identityInterface对象来访问当前用户的身份接口(interface)\Yii::$app->user->identity->id;有没有办法获取和设置额外的参数(无需扩展身份类)?基本上等同于Yii1.xgetState()和CWebUser中的setState()方法来存储和检索session信息,例如这个Yii::app()->user->setState("some_attribute",$value);Yii::app()->user->getState('some_attribute',$defaul

php - 真正破坏 PHP session ?

我听到了关于这个话题的不同react,那么什么是破坏PHPsession的可靠方法呢?session_start();if(isset($_SESSION['foo'])){unset($_SESSION['foo'];...}session_destroy();在最简单的情况下,这足以真正终止用户和服务器之间的session吗? 最佳答案 要销毁session,您应该采取以下步骤:删除session数据使sessionID无效为此,我会使用这个:session_start();//resetsthesessiondataforth

php - 真正破坏 PHP session ?

我听到了关于这个话题的不同react,那么什么是破坏PHPsession的可靠方法呢?session_start();if(isset($_SESSION['foo'])){unset($_SESSION['foo'];...}session_destroy();在最简单的情况下,这足以真正终止用户和服务器之间的session吗? 最佳答案 要销毁session,您应该采取以下步骤:删除session数据使sessionID无效为此,我会使用这个:session_start();//resetsthesessiondataforth

php - Cookie session 驱动程序不会保存任何验证错误或闪存数据

我在Laravel中使用cookiesession驱动程序时遇到了麻烦。我有一个简单的表格,其中有一个验证。这是我保存此表单数据的方法:publicfunctionstore(){$this->validate(request(),['name'=>'required','title'=>'required','description'=>'required|max:600','image'=>'required|file|mimes:jpeg,png',]);$member=TeamMember::create(request()->all());$member->addImage(

php - Cookie session 驱动程序不会保存任何验证错误或闪存数据

我在Laravel中使用cookiesession驱动程序时遇到了麻烦。我有一个简单的表格,其中有一个验证。这是我保存此表单数据的方法:publicfunctionstore(){$this->validate(request(),['name'=>'required','title'=>'required','description'=>'required|max:600','image'=>'required|file|mimes:jpeg,png',]);$member=TeamMember::create(request()->all());$member->addImage(

php - PHP 中的 REMOTE_ADDR 和 IPv6

假设$_SERVER['REMOTE_ADDR']总是返回IPv4地址是否安全?谢谢! 最佳答案 REMOTE_ADDR键由网络服务器设置,而不是PHP。如果Web服务器在v6上监听并且用户以这种方式连接,它将是一个v6地址 关于php-PHP中的REMOTE_ADDR和IPv6,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/2619634/